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method and system, wherein, if described mat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method comprises the steps: S1, dry temperature sensor is respectively arranged at each temperature acquisition point in the matrix form, if the matrix that described dry temperature sensor is formed is designated as m × n;S2, opening each temperature sensor of the 1st row in temperature sensor matrix, and close other temperature sensors, each temperature sensor to the 1st row carries out temperature acquisition;The temperature that S3, storage are gathered by each temperature sensor of the 1st row;S4, temperature acquisition mode according to step S2~S3, line by line to the 2nd trip temperature sensor ..., m trip temperature sensor carries out temperature acquisition.The mat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method of the present invention have temperature voltage gather accurately, can collection point substantial amounts, gather that number of conductors is few, the advantage of Ultra Low Cost.

Detailed description of the invention
The present invention is described in detail for each embodiment shown in below in conjunction with the accompanying drawings, but it should explanation, these
Embodiment not limitation of the present invention, those of ordinary skill in the art according to these embodiment institute work energy, method,
Or the equivalent transformation in structure or replacement, within belonging to protection scope of the present invention.
The mat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method of the present invention can promptly and accurately monitor all batteries state of temperature, carry
Rise the security performance of electric automobile, be provided simultaneously with high cost performance to meet the cost requirement of electric automobile commercialization.Below
Technical scheme is described in detail:
As shown in Figure 1, 2, the mat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method of the present invention comprises the steps:
If S1, dry temperature sensor being respectively arranged in the matrix form each temperature acquisition point, described some temperature sensing
The matrix that device is formed is designated as m × n.
Wherein, described temperature sensor can be critesistor.Described each temperature acquisition point may be located at printed circuit board (PCB)
Or on flexible PCB.Accordingly, due to using mat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method, thus, it is possible to arrange enormous amount
Temperature acquisition point.
Meanwhile, in temperature sensor matrix, it is electrically connected with by wire between each temperature sensor, specifically, appoints
Each temperature sensor of a line is electrically connected with by wire Li, and each temperature sensor of either rank is electrically connected with by wire Cj,
Wherein, i=1 ..., m, j=1 ..., n.Thus, the quantity of the wire connecting each temperature sensor is m+n root, and it is relative
In existing acquisition method, number of conductors greatly reduces.
S2, open each temperature sensor of the 1st row in temperature sensor matrix by switch R1, and close other temperature and pass
Sensor, each temperature sensor to the 1st row carries out temperature acquisition.
The mat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method picking rate of the present invention is fast, specifically, each temperature sensor of the first row with
And the temperature acquisition time of each temperature sensor of other row can be less than 10ms, thus, total moisture content acquisition time is less than 10 × m
ms.Meanwhile, in gatherer process, acquisition precision is high, and concordance is high, overcomes in existing acquisition method, occurs when gathering data
The problem of difference.It should be noted that in the mat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ition method of the present invention of the present invention, every trip temperature collection
Time is not limited to less than 10ms, in other embodiments, it is also possible to more than 10ms, total time is more than 10 × m ms, i.e. root
Different according to the sampling number sampling time often gone.
The temperature that S3, storage are gathered by each temperature sensor of the 1st row.
S4, temperature acquisition mode according to step S2~S3, line by line to the 2nd trip temperature sensor ..., m trip temperature
Sensor carries out temperature acquisition.
Furthermore, it is necessary to explanation, during carrying out temperature acquisition line by line, at the temperature sensor of collected a line
In duty, other the most collected temperature sensors do not work.For achieving the above object, wire Li is provided with control to open
Pass Ri (wherein, i=1 ..., m).Thus, in gatherer process, the switch that the temperature sensor of collected a line is corresponding closes
Close, meanwhile, other corresponding switching off of the most collected temperature sensor.
As it is shown on figure 3, based on identical inventive concept, the present invention also provides for a kind of matrix-scanning-type temperature acquisition system,
If comprising: temperature collect module 10 and dry temperature sensor 20.
Wherein, if described dry temperature sensor 20 is respectively arranged at each temperature acquisition point, each temperature acquisition in the matrix form
Temperature sensor 20 on point forms temperature sensor matrix m × n.Preferably, described temperature sensor 20 is critesistor.Institute
State each temperature acquisition point to be positioned on printed circuit board (PCB) or flexible PCB.
In temperature sensor 20 matrix m × n, each temperature sensor 20 of any row is electrically connected with by wire Li, and with
Described temperature collect module 10 is electrically connected with, and each temperature sensor 20 of either rank is electrically connected with by wire Cj, and with described
Temperature collect module 10 is electrically connected with, wherein, i=1 ..., m, j=1 ..., n.
Additionally, be provided with switch on wire between the temperature sensor 20 of any row and described temperature collect module 10
30, the quantity of described switch 30 is m.
